About The Messiah Academy

The Messiah Academy is a private elementary school in Temple Hills, MD. The Messiah Academy serves approximately 37 students, and covers grades Pre-K-4th, and has a 7.7:1 student-teacher ratio. The Messiah Academy has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.5 out of 10 and ranks #286 of 378 private schools in MD.

What Parents Should Know

At 37 students, The Messiah Academy is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.

At 7.7:1 students to teachers, The Messiah Academy sits well below the national average. Smaller classes like that usually mean more one-on-one time between students and teachers.

The Messiah Academy is private, so it runs independently of the local district and sets its own curriculum. That freedom cuts both ways depending on what you want for your child. If you're considering it, start with the practical questions: tuition, financial aid, and how admissions work.
